Summary

This collection of technical articles, written by leading international researchers in robotics, presents threads of modern robotics research. Topics explored in these chapters include:Mobile robots in extreme environments Autonomous spacecraft The design of networked robotic systems Robotic grasping using inputs from vision systems Advances in manipulation and mobility inspired by human control systems New directions in human-robot interaction A biomimetic approach to autonomous robot design Applying multi-task learning to inverse dynamics Researchers and students will be inspired by these contributions and the volume will undoubtedly spur further reading and research in the field.
